A global engineering firm seeks a Country Manager for England to lead business development. The ideal candidate is a Civil Engineer with over 10 years of experience in road or railway infrastructure and strong industry connections.

This role involves developing markets, leading the commercial cycle, and ensuring customer satisfaction. The position requires frequent travel, making it essential to be independent, hands-on, and results-driven.

Suitable candidates will be contacted directly as part of a confidential search.
